Output 844732d8c5a9810f8954591c666210ace8e55cdfa3495a4c22aa5cd061352726:43
- value
- 579325
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ff1af1676be6b4bbf30d91e1ddea135d8738d277 OP_EQUAL
- address
- 3QwtWVUwdVBDMVBSMntJSWFwV5rutjwE7C
- transaction
- 844732d8c5a9810f8954591c666210ace8e55cdfa3495a4c22aa5cd061352726